Data usage typically refers to the amount of data that is transferred between a user’s device and the network within a specific time period. This data can include various types of information, such as web browsing, email, streaming media, app downloads, and more.

Data usage is usually measured in units of bytes (or kilobytes, megabytes, gigabytes, etc.) and can be tracked by both the user and the service provider. Users can monitor their data usage through their device’s settings or by using specific apps or tools provided by their service provider.

Mobile data usage is particularly relevant for smartphones and other mobile devices that connect to cellular networks. Many mobile service providers offer data plans with specific data allowances, limiting the amount of data that can be used within a billing cycle. If a user exceeds their data allowance, they may face additional charges or experience a reduction in network speed.

It’s worth noting that data usage can also apply to other types of networks, such as home internet connections. Internet service providers (ISPs) often have data caps or limits on the amount of data that can be consumed within a specific time period.

Monitoring data usage can help users stay within their limits, avoid unexpected charges, and manage their internet or mobile plan effectively.

Tele-calling, also known as telemarketing or telephone marketing, is a method of direct marketing where sales representatives or agents make phone calls to potential customers or existing clients to promote products, services, or gather information. Tele-calling can be conducted by businesses, organizations, or call centers with specific objectives in mind.

 

Here are a few reasons why tele-calling is used:

  1. Lead Generation: Tele-calling is often employed to generate leads for sales and marketing purposes. Agents contact potential customers, qualify them based on specific criteria, and identify prospects who show interest in the product or service being offered.
  2. Sales and Promotions: Tele-calling is an effective tool for sales promotion. Agents can reach out to customers, inform them about new products, discounts, special offers, or upcoming sales events, and persuade them to make a purchase.
  3. Market Research: Companies may use tele-calling to conduct market research and gather valuable information about customer preferences, opinions, and buying behaviors. These insights can help businesses refine their marketing strategies and tailor their offerings to meet customer needs.
  4. Customer Service and Support: Tele-calling is also used for providing customer service and support. Customers can reach out to a helpline or call center to get assistance with their queries, complaints, or technical issues. Tele-calling agents are trained to handle customer inquiries and provide the necessary support.
  5.  Appointment Setting: Tele-calling is often employed to schedule appointments or meetings with potential clients. Sales representatives can call prospects and arrange a time for a sales presentation, demonstration, or consultation.
